- Collect client feedback through various channels that IRC maintains, including hotline, suggestion boxes, email, in person through field visits or focus group discussions, etc.
- Receive, record, and classify feedback based on the IRC SOP; update the Feedback Registry on everyday basis and timely refer cases to relevant Sector Focal Points, Safeguarding team, and/or other departments if needed.
- Support the Senior CRA Officer with closing the loop for all feedback cases by maintaining close communication and collaboration with the Sector Focal Points.
- Prepare and conduct field visits in order to promote Client Feedback Mechanism at IRC, including preparation of paper-based data collection tools, promotional materials, etc.
- Facilitate the establishment of feasible feedback channel and routine follow-up for its functionality.
- Aggregate and dis-aggregate client feedback (according to gender, age, status, sector, risk-level and other client appropriate dis-aggregation).
- Together with the Senior CRA officer present statistics on feedback received and feedback content in clear formats to highlight feedback trends to the program team.
- Support the Senior CRA Officer in analyzing key themes, challenges, and opportunities for program improvement.
- Support the Senior MEAL Officers and MEAL Manager in the implementation of ongoing monitoring and evaluation activities, including field-level data collection, analysis, and reporting.
- Assist in the aggregation and disaggregation of program implementation data to ensure accurate and timely updates to the client tracker and the Indicator Performance Tracking Table (IPTT).
